Job DetailsJob Location: Draper 1 - Draper, UT 84020Job Summary: A classroom instructor works with a K-6 homeroom teacher to meet the needs of the students in the homeroom classes. Instructors also teach math and reading groups, help supervise lunch and recess, and help their homeroom teacher with other important tasks that need to be done throughout the school day. Duties/Responsibilities: Assist homeroom teacher (grading, making copies, etc.) Teach basic reading and math groups to small groups (average of 10-15 students) Assist students with special education needs and accommodations Monitor lunch, recess, transitions and assembly behavior Keep record of grades and special education data QualificationsRequired Skills/Abilities: Successful candidates will be: Energetic, enthusiastic, and committed to student success No license required Able to work well in a teamwork environment, including participation in a coaching model for teaching Able to demonstrate good classroom management skills A college degree is not necessary for an instructor position, and we will train and coach instructors until they are confident in their job duties. Instructors work 36.5 hours a week and only work during the school year (off during school vacations). Successful candidates must meet highly qualified status in one of three ways: Earned an Associates Degree; or Earned 48 college credit hours; or Successfully completing a basic academic skills (parapro) exam within the first week of hire. Job Benefits: Health, Dental and Vision insurance will be offered.
